APPLICATION OF PRICE LIST
This price list contains the regulations and rates applicable to the provision of intrastate resale
common carrier communications and automated operator services by Inmate Calling Solutions, LLC
d/b/a ICSolutions for use by inmates in correctional institutions within the State ofIdaho subject to the
jurisdiction of the Idaho Public Utilities Commission.
SERVICE AREA MAP
Inmate Calling Solutions, LLC d/b/a ICSolutions will provide intrastate resale common carrier
communications and automated operator services throughout the State ofIdaho.

SECTION 1 -TECHNICAL TERMS AND ABBREVIATIONS,(CONT'D.)
Inmates -The jailed or confined population ofcorrectional or confinement institutions.
Jail -A facility of a local,state or federal law enforcement agency that is used primarily to hold (N)
individuals who are (1)awaiting adjudication of criminal charges;(2)post-conviction and committed to I
confinement for sentences ofone year or less;(3)post conviction and awaiting transfer to another facility.I
The term also includes city,county or regional facilities that have contracted with a private company to I
manage day-to-day operations;privately-owned and operated facilities primarily engaged in housing city,I
county or regional inmates;and facilities used to detain individuals pursuant to a contract with U.S.I
Immigration and Customs Enforcement.(N)
LEC -Local Exchange Company.
Prison -A facility operated by a territorial,state or federal agency that is used primarily to confine (N)
individuals convicted of felonies and sentenced to terms in excess of one year.The term also includes I
public and private facilities that provide outsource housing to other agencies such as the State I
Departments of Correction and the Federal Bureau of Prisons;and facilities that would otherwise fall I
under the definition of a Jail but in which the majority of inmates are post-conviction or are committed to I
confinement for sentences longer than one year.(N)
Subscriber -The correctional institution which orders or uses ICS's service and is responsible for
compliance with price list regulations.The Subscriber enters into an agreement with the Company for the
provision of collect-only automated operator assisted telecommunications services for use by inmates.

1. Public Telephone Surcharge
In order to recover the Company s expenses to comply with the FCC's pay telephone
compensation plan effective on October 7, 1997 (FCC 97-371), an undiscountable per call
charge is applicable to all interstate, intrastate and international calls that originate from any
domestic pay telephone used to access the Company s services. This surcharge, which is in
addition to standard price listed usage charges and any applicable service charges and
surcharges associated with the Company s service, applies for the use of the instrument used
to access the Company s service and is unrelated to the service accessed from the pay
telephone.
Pay telephones include coin-operated and coinless phones owned by local telephone
companies, independent companies and other interexchange carriers. The Public Pay
Telephone Surcharge applies to the initial completed call and anyre-originated call (i., using
the "#" symbol).
Whenever possible, the Public Pay Telephone Surcharge will appear on the same invoice
containing the usage charges for the surcharged call. In cases where proper pay telephone
coding digits are not transmitted to the Company prior to completion of a call, the Public Pay
Telephone Surcharge may be billed on a subsequent invoice after the Company has obtained
information from a carrier that the originating station is an eligible pay telephone.
The Public Pay Telephone Surcharge does not apply to calls placed from pay telephones at
which the Customer pays for service by inserting coins during the progress of the call.
Rate Per Call:$0.47

Call Restrictions
Calling capabilities may be restricted by the administration of the correctional or confinement
institutions. The following types of calls will be blocked: directory assistance, 0-, 700, 800, 900, 976
950, 10XXX, 1+ sent paid, third number billed, credit card and local direct. The institution may block
calls to specific telephone numbers and may limit calling service to pre-approved telephone numbers
only. Call duration may be limited by the institution.

General
SECTION 3 - DESCRIPTION OF SERVICE AND RATES
Service is offered to inmates of correctional or confinement facilities for outward-only calling. Collect
calls may be billed to residential or business lines. Billing information will be validated.
Timing of Calls
Long distance usage charges are based on the actual usage ofICS's network. Timing of a call
begins when the called party accepts the charges for the call. Positive response for acceptance
of a call is required. A call will be terminated within five (5) seconds from the last message
given if no positive response is received.
Chargeable time for a call ends upon disconnection by either party.
The minimum call duration and initial period for billing purposes is one minute.
Unless otherwise specified in this price list, for billing purposes usage is measured and
rounded to the next higher full minute.
No charges apply for incomplete calls or for calls to called parties who do not accept the
charges for the call. ICS will terminate a call if the called party does not accept responsibility
for the charges. If a Customer believes he or she has been incorrectly billed for an incomplete
call, the Company will, upon notification, investigate the circumstances ofthe call and issue a
credit when appropriate.

SECTION 3 -DESCRIPTION OF SERVICE AND RATES,(CONT'D.)
3.3 ICS Institutional Automated Collect Operator Service
ICS provides Institutional Automated Collect Operator Service to inmates of confinement
facilities.Service may be limited by the administrators of the institutions as to availability,call
duration or calling scope.Calls are billed to the Called Party.The Called Party must actively
accept charges for the call.(D)
Institutional automated collect operator service allows inmates to make collect calls to
terminating locations anywhere within in the state.An automated system prompts the.caller and
the called party through user -friendly instructions.The called party must accept responsibility
for payment of the charges by dialing the designated digit for acceptance.If a call is not accepted
within five (5)seconds of the automated voice recording prompt,the automated recording is
replayed a second time.If an acceptance digit is not received five (5)seconds after the second
recording is completed,the call is terminated by ICS'system.
Use of the automated collect calling service is subject to the rules and regulations of the
Commission and the institution's administrative restrictions.
3.3.1 Classes of Calls
Automated Collect Station Calls:are calls which are placed by an Inmate who dials all
of the digits required to route the call and who follows the ICS system prompts,enabling
the Called Party to accept the charges for the call.If the Called Party does not accept the
call,the call is terminated and no billing applies

SECTION 3 - DESCRIPTION OF SERVICE AND RATES, (CONT'
ICS Prepaid Institutional Calling Services
3.4.General
ICS Prepaid Institutional Calling Services provide alternative payment arrangements for
inmates in Confinement Institutions. This service is designed to offer a calling alternative for
the following circumstances:
Called parties who utilize the services of local exchange carriers that do not offer third
party billing of collect calls; and
Called parties whose credit history is inadequate to receive collect calls; and
Inmates who wish to utilize their commissary funds for call placement; and
Called parties who wish to budget their monthly expense for collect calls.
Prepaid Institutional Calling Services are not subject to the Deposit and Advance Payment
provisions found in Section 2.
Two options are available with Prepaid Institutional Calling Services. The first option, the
Debit Card/Debit Account , allows the inmate (via the Institution personnel) to set up his/her
own account/card at the Confinement Institution; the second option, Prepaid Collect Service
allows the Called Party who receives collect calls from inmates to set up his/her own prepaid
account.

SECTION 3 -DESCRIPTION OF SERVICE AND RATES,(CONT'D.)
3.4 ICS Prepaid Institutional Calling Services,(Cont'd.)
3.4.1 General,(Cont'd.)
A.Prepaid Debit Service (T)
With a Debit Card or Debit Account,each inmate has the option to transfer funds (T)
from his/her commissary account to purchase a debit card or have calls paid for
directly out of the inmate's commissary account.This is accomplished by
facility personnel or through a direct interface between the commissary system
and the inmate phone system.This account is associated with the inmate's
Personal Identification Number (PIN.)When the inmate places a call,he/she has
the option of calling collect or debit.Once debit is selected,the inmate enters the
PIN and called telephone number.All purchases on a Debit Account are paid to (T)
and handled by the Institution.The Company receives payment from the
Institution;it does not engage in direct monetary transactions with the inmate.
Debit cards or Debit Accounts may be purchased in any amount subject to the (T)
requirements or restrictions ofthe Confinement Institution.
The Company's system automatically informs the caller of the amount of (T)
purchased services applied to or remaining on the Prepaid Account,and provides I
prompts to place the call by entering the destination telephone number.The I
charge for network usage is deducted from the Account on a real time basis as (T)
the call progresses.
Debit Card or Debit Account services expire six (6)months from the date of (T)
purchase/sale.Since services are consumed in the order purchased,each new I
purchase will typically reset the expiration timeframe.Consumers may cancel I
services and request a refund prior to expiration.No refunds will be issued after I
the service expiration date.(T)

SECTION 3 -DESCRIPTION OF SERVICE AND RATES,(CONT'D.)
3.4 ICS Prepaid Institutional Calling,(Cont'd.)
3.4.1 General,(Cont'd.)
B.Prepaid Collect Service (T)
Prepaid Collect Service is available for those parties (Customers)who receive
collect calls from inmates in Confinement Institutions.Upon request,a prepaid (T)
account is set up by the Company for the Customer.The inmate will receive an
authorization code,and instructions for accessing and using the service.If the
payment into the account is provided via the Customer's credit card,credit
verification procedures are carried out under the terms specified in Section 2 of
this tariff.Payments to the account are made to and handled by the Company via (T)
arrangement with a specified financial institution.The Company does not engage
in direct monetary transactions with the inmate.
The Company's system automatically informs the account holder of purchased (T)
services applied to or remaining on the Prepaid Account prior to acceptance of I
the call.The charge for network usage is deducted from the Account in full I
minute increments on a real time basis as the call progresses.The account holder (T)
will also receive a reminder message when the account balance has one minute of
usage remaining.All calls must be charged against an Account that has sufficient
available balance.Calls in progress will be terminated by the Company if the
balance on the Account is insufficient to continue the call.
Prepaid Collect services expire six (6)months from the date of purchase/sale.(T)
Consumers may request a refund for any unexpired services.Since services are I
consumed in the order purchased,each new purchase will typically reset the I
expiration timeframe.Consumers may cancel services and request a refund prior I
to expiration.No refunds will be issued after the expiration date.(T)
Initial or additional deposits to prepaid services may be made via selected retail (T)
outlets with which the Company may contract to receive Customer payments,or
via Western Union,commercial credit card,debit card or e-checks.Payments
may be made in any amount.
Prepaid Collect Services are available 24 hours a day,seven days per week.(T)
Access to telephone service by an inmate may be subject to time of day and
usage restrictions imposed by individual Confinement Institutions.No minimum
service period applies.
Charges for network usage for Prepaid Institutional Calls are deducted from the (T)
Account in full minute increments on a real time basis as the call progresses.The I
account holder will also receive a reminder message when the account balance I
has one minute of usage remaining.All calls must be charged against an Account I
that has sufficient available balance.Calls in progress will be terminated by the I
Company ifthe balance on the Account is insufficient to continue the call.(T)
